'Killing' star in talks for 'World War Z'

According to The Hollywood Reporter, Enos will play Brad Pitt's wife in the highly-anticipated adaptation of Max Brooks's novel. Set ten years after the outbreak of a zombie epidemic, World War Z is written in the format of an oral history, featuring a collection of stories in the form of first-person anecdotes.
The film will be directed by Marc Forster (Quantum of Solace, The Kite Runner).
Pitt signed on to star in the film last July. He will also produce the movie through his production company Plan B.
Enos currently stars in AMC's The Killing, where she plays homicide detective Sarah Linden. The actress recently revealed that she has not seen the original version of the AMC television show, the Danish series Forbrydelsen.
World War Z is scheduled for release in 2014. The Killing airs Sundays at 10/9c on AMC.
